logo

Taglio della stringa JavaScript()

trim() è una funzione di stringa incorporata in JavaScript, che viene utilizzata per tagliare una stringa. Questa funzione rimuove gli spazi bianchi da entrambe le estremità, ovvero dall'inizio e dalla fine della stringa. Poiché trim() è un metodo stringa, viene invocato da un'istanza della classe String. Dobbiamo creare un'istanza di Classe di stringhe con cui verrà utilizzato il metodo trim().

Nota: il metodo trim() non modifica la stringa originale; rimuove semplicemente il carattere dello spazio bianco iniziale e finale.

Sintassi

La sintassi del metodo trim() è la seguente:

elenco delle freccette
 str.trim() 

Qui, str è una classe di oggetto String che conterrà la stringa da tagliare.

Parametri

Il metodo trim() non contiene argomenti o parametri al suo interno.

Valore di ritorno

La funzione string.trim() restituisce la stringa dopo aver rimosso il carattere di spazio bianco dall'inizio e dalla fine della stringa.

Esempi

Di seguito sono riportati alcuni esempi che utilizzano la funzione trim() per rimuovere gli elementi da essa. In questi esempi vedrai come usarlo Funzione JavaScript . Quindi, ecco alcuni esempi:

Esempio 1

In questo esempio, passeremo una stringa contenente spazi bianchi su entrambe le estremità.

 function func_trim() { //original string with whitespace in beginning and end var str = ' javatpoint tutorial website '; //string trimmed using trim() var trimmedstr = str.trim(); document.write(trimmedstr); } func_trim(); 
Provalo adesso

Produzione

Ciò restituirà la stringa seguente dopo aver rimosso gli spazi bianchi.

 Javatpoint tutorial website 

Esempio 2

In questo esempio passeremo una stringa contenente spazi solo alla fine.

 function func_trim() { //original string with whitespace at the end var str = 'javatpoint tutorial website '; //string trimmed using trim() var trimmedstr = str.trim(); document.write(trimmedstr); } func_trim(); 
Provalo adesso

Produzione

Ciò rimuoverà lo spazio bianco dalla fine e restituirà la stringa come indicato di seguito.

 Javatpoint tutorial website 

Esempio 3

In questo esempio passeremo una stringa contenente spazi solo all'inizio.

 function func_trim() { //original string with whitespace in beginning var str = ' javatpoint tutorial website'; //string trimmed using trim() var trimmedstr = str.trim(); document.write(trimmedstr); } func_trim(); 
Provalo adesso

Produzione

Ciò rimuoverà lo spazio bianco dall'inizio e restituirà la stringa come indicato di seguito.

elenco collegato Java
 Javatpoint tutorial website 

JavaScript offre altre due funzioni simili al metodo trim(). Usavano anche tagliare la corda ma solo da un'estremità, sinistra o destra. Ricorda che entrambe le funzioni non modificano la stringa originale; rimuovono semplicemente gli spazi bianchi.

  • tagliare a sinistra()
  • tagliareDestra()

tagliare a sinistra()

IL tagliare a sinistra() Il metodo rimuove lo spazio bianco solo dalla sinistra della stringa. Per capirci meglio possiamo dire che rimuove gli spazi solo dall'inizio e restituisce la stringa senza alcun carattere di spazio iniziale.

Sintassi

 str.trimLeft() 

Vedi l'esempio qui sotto -

Esempio 1

 function func_trim() { //original string with whitespace in beginning var str = ' javatpoint tutorial website '; //string trimmed using trimLeft() var trimmedstr = str.trimLeft(); document.write(trimmedstr); } func_trim(); 
Provalo adesso

Produzione

Ciò rimuoverà lo spazio bianco solo dall'inizio e lo spazio bianco finale rimarrà lo stesso. Vedere l'output di seguito:

 Javatpoint tutorial website 

tagliareDestra()

D'altra parte, il tagliareDestra() Il metodo rimuove lo spazio bianco solo dalla destra della stringa. Per capire meglio, possiamo dire che rimuove gli spazi bianchi solo alla fine e restituisce la stringa senza alcun carattere di spazio bianco finale.

Sintassi

 str.trimRight() 

Vedi l'esempio qui sotto -

Esempio 1

 function func_trim() { //original string with whitespace from the end var str = ' javatpoint tutorial website '; //string trimmed using trimRight() var trimmedstr = str.trimRight(); document.write(trimmedstr); } func_trim(); 
Provalo adesso

Produzione

Ciò rimuoverà lo spazio bianco solo dalla fine e lo spazio bianco iniziale rimarrà lo stesso. Vedere l'output di seguito:

 Javatpoint tutorial website